(Franklin County, Ind.) - The Franklin County Election Division is sharing some important information regarding the 2026 Primary Election.

The last day to register to vote or to transfer your registration is Monday, April 6 by 4:00 p.m. in the Franklin County Clerk’s Office. You may also register to vote, check registration status, check polling locations and request an absentee ballot online at Indianavoters.in.gov 

Tuesday, April 7 is the first day that a voter may cast their ballot before the early voter board in the Franklin County Courthouse, 459 Main Street, Brookville, Indiana. Those hours are:

  • April 7-10: 8:30 a.m. to 4:00 p.m.
  • April 13-17: 8:30 a.m. to 4:00 p.m.                                      
  • April 20-24: 8:30 a.m. to 4:00 p.m.                                    
  • April 27-May 1: 8:30 a.m. to 4:00 p.m.                                       

Voting hours will be extended to 7:00 p.m. on Thursday, April 23 and Thursday, April 30.

Saturday hours and locations are as follows: 

  • April 25: 8:00 a.m. to 3:00 p.m.
  • May 2: 8:00 a.m. to 3:00 p.m. 
  • Clerk’s Office 459 Main Street
  • Ignite (Church on Fire) 1170 State Road 229, Batesville

Monday, May 4 at noon is the last day to vote an early ballot before the early voter board in the Clerk’s Office.

Those voters who wish to vote by mail or have the traveling board come to their house to vote, may contact the Clerk’s office for an Absentee Ballot Application. Call the Clerk’s office at 765-647-5111 ext. 3 for an application or if you have any questions. Thursday, April 23 is the LAST DAY for the Clerk’s Office to receive an application to vote by mail.
